Anyone hear this yet? I'm pretty blown away by it. I thought I would receive and album full of average material, but I got much, much more. New MC & Unicus (lead emcees) come correct on this one.

What really made me buy it is the fact it's completely produced by Big Jess. He's from the Unknown Prophets (out of Minneapolis), who happens to be my favorite local group, and has been for years. His production has been top notch for years, but this may be his most diverse offering yet.

I've already bumped this CD 10+ times (and rate it at 4.5 stars). I recommend it, to say the least.
